Squash Heads to Drexel Saturday, Hosts GW Sunday
11/22/2019 5:03:00 PM | Men's Squash, Women's Squash
Undefeated squash programs look to continue early season success
NEW YORK – The Columbia men's and women's squash teams go up against Drexel and George Washington this weekend. The Lions travel to Drexel on Saturday before returning home to host the Colonials on Sunday at the SL Green Streetsquash courts.

Men's Preview:
The No. 7-ranked Lions will look to maintain their undefeated start. Columbia has beaten Drexel in each of its last three matchups dating back to the 2015-16 season. Last weekend, they swept both Fordham and NYU, 9-0, at the SL Green Streetsquash courts. Sunday's home match against GW will mark the seventh between the two teams over the eight years. Columbia has won each of those last seven matchups.
Women's Preview:
The No. 6-ranked women's team also swept its competition last weekend, defeating Fordham, 9-0 and NYU, 8-0, at the SL Green Streetsquash courts. The Lions will be looking to make it six straight years with a win over the Dragons. Last season, Columbia edged out Drexel, 5-4, in New York. The Columbia women also ride a three-match winning streak against George Washington, including a 9-0 sweep last year down in D.C.
Scouting Drexel:
Both Drexel teams currently hold an overall record of 1-1. On the men's side, the Dragons swept the Franklin & Marshall Diplomats in their first match of the season, winning, 9-0. That success was halted by a loss against No. 3 Penn, 6-3, last Sunday. Last year, Drexel finished with an overall record of 7-10. On the women's side, the Dragons defeated Franklin & Marshall, 8-1, on Saturday but also lost to No. 8 Penn at the Kline & Specter Squash Center, 5-4. They concluded last season with a 8-8 overall record.
Scouting George Washington:
Both George Washington teams currently hold an overall record of 1-1. The men's team started the season strong with a clean win against Georgetown University, 9-0. They weren't able to have the same result in the matchup against the University of Virginia, losing by a final of 7-2. The Colonials had an overall record of 13-12 last year and a five-game winning streak within the season. The women's team began with a strong start as well, sweeping Georgetown, 9-0. They were defeated by Princeton, 8-1, on Sunday. George Washington's women's team is coming off a 5-15 season from a year ago.
